摘要:Carbon nanotubes (CNTs) have been considered as promising reinforcements for various composites due to their excellent mechanical properties. However, CNT/resin composites prepared so far still suffer from bad dispersion, low mass fraction, and poor alignment of CNTs and their weak bonding with the resin matrix. Herein, we report an effective strategy towards preparing CNT/epoxy (EP) composite films with excellent mechanical properties. Firstly, from floating catalytic spray pyrolysis, CNTs are continuously deposited on a substrate make a thin film. The pristine film is then immersed in solutions of different EP concentrations under pressure and stretched to different strains for resin infiltration and CNT reorientation. The film was finally pressed at a low temperature for resin redistribution and then at a high temperature for resin curing. The determining factors such as the alignment and mass fraction of CNTs and the distribution of EP resin in the composite film can be easily tailored. Benefiting from a high CNT content (60.56 wt.%), excellent CNT alignment from repeated prestretching, and uniform resin distribution between CNTs from pressurized impregnation and low temperature pressing, the composite film can achieve excellent mechanical properties, including a tensile strength of 4.1 GPa, elongation at break of 3.8%, and toughness of 77.9 J cm-3. Such a strength and toughness are superior to those for the previous CNT and carbon fiber composites published in the literature. ? 2024, The Authors. All rights reserved.
